Technical Highlights: Engineering Precision
- External Combustion Power: This engine operates on the principle of cyclic compression and expansion of air at different temperatures. It is a closed-cycle heat engine, meaning the working gas is permanently contained within the system.
- Quartz Glass Cylinder: The heating cylinder is made from thick quartz glass. We chose quartz for its exceptional thermal shock resistance—it can withstand the rapid temperature changes from the alcohol flame without cracking, while providing a crystal-clear view of the piston's movement.
- Low-Friction Mechanics: The power piston is engineered with high precision to fit the cylinder perfectly. This "dry fit" design eliminates the need for lubricants, ensuring the engine runs cleanly and efficiently without the drag caused by viscous oils.

Important Tips from the Expert
- Fuel Matters: Always use 95% purity alcohol (not included). Lower purity options contain too much water, which lowers the flame temperature and may prevent the engine from generating enough power to run.
- Keep it Dry: Never apply oil or grease to the piston or glass cylinder. While it seems counterintuitive, oil will mix with dust to form a sticky sludge that creates friction and stops the engine. The graphite/metal fit is self-lubricating.
- Safety Precaution: The metal components and glass cylinder become extremely hot during operation. Allow the engine to cool down naturally for at least 10 minutes before touching or storing it.
